Title: | First addendum to the EIA for the proposed domestic airport development in DH. Kudahuvadhoo |

Abstract: | This report addresses the environmental concerns of the newly proposed burrow area for the
reclamation of the Domestic Airport in Dh.Kudhahuvadhoo. The previously considered
burrow areas posed technical difficulties in getting the required amount of sand which was
needed for the project, therefore the new burrow area was proposed in the shallow area close
to the proposed deeper borrow areas. An area of about 150,000-170,000m2 in the shallow area
close to the approved dredge area is to be dredged to a depth of 6-7m to obtain about
750,000m3 of fill material. This area has been selected because one of the approved areas is
too deep to dredge with the dredger. Also, the other approved areas have hard rock as a result
of which the total volume of material is reduced.
Since the proposed area is in close proximity to the proposed area and further away from the
reef and reef patches than the proposed areas, the proposed new area has lesser environmental
impacts than that proposed. However, the impacts of dredging would be similar to those of
the already approved areas. The main impacts of the proposed component are related to
changes in coastal water quality and oceanography, impacts on coral reefs and the associated
marine fauna. Mitigation measures are mainly focused on reducing sedimentation, dredging
methods and timings of the dredging. Monitoring programme outlined in the EIA report was
found to be sufficient and additional environmental monitoring was not found to be necessary.
Given that the change in the project component does not have major negative environmental
impacts it is recommended to allow the project to proceed as proposed. |
